Maxim Integrated MAX913CSA technical specifications, attributes, parameters and parts with similar specifications to Maxim Integrated MAX913CSA .
- Factory Lead Time6 Weeks
- Mounting TypeSurface Mount
- Package / Case8-SOIC (0.154, 3.90mm Width)
- Surface MountYES
- Number of Pins8
- Operating Temperature0°C~70°C
- PackagingTube
- Published2003
- JESD-609 Codee3
- Pbfree Codeyes
- Part StatusActive
- Moisture Sensitivity Level (MSL)1 (Unlimited)
- Number of Terminations8
- ECCN CodeEAR99
- Terminal FinishMatte Tin (Sn)
- SubcategoryComparators
- TechnologyBIPOLAR
- Terminal PositionDUAL
- Terminal FormGULL WING
- Peak Reflow Temperature (Cel)260
- Number of Functions1
- Supply Voltage5V
- Reflow Temperature-Max (s)NOT SPECIFIED
- Base Part NumberMAX913
- Pin Count8
- Qualification StatusNot Qualified
- Output TypeComplementary, TTL
- Number of Elements1
- Power Supplies5/ -5V
- Response Time10 ns
- Voltage - Supply, Single/Dual (±)5V~10V
- Neg Supply Voltage-Nom (Vsup)-5V
- Supply Voltage Limit-Max7V
- Neg Supply Voltage-Max (Vsup)-7V
- Current - Quiescent (Max)10mA
- Voltage - Input Offset (Max)2mV @ ±5V
- Current - Input Bias (Max)5μA @ ±5V
- CMRR, PSRR (Typ)110dB CMRR, 100dB PSRR
- Current - Output (Typ)20mA
- Propagation Delay (Max)14ns
- Length4.9mm
- Width3.9mm
- RoHS StatusROHS3 Compliant
- Lead FreeLead Free
